  3. 时事评论员林和立向本台表示,均不可信。他引述消息人士指出,习近平是对十八大之后的七名政治局常委人选不满,因为当中有三人是胡锦涛总书记的亲信与团派人马,即李克强、李源潮与汪洋,而他领导的太子党虽然同样有三席,即习本人加王岐山与俞正声,但后二人年纪不轻,可能只能干一届。另一不满是胡锦涛不愿裸退,会留任军委主席至少两年,仿效江泽民当年的垂帘听政,故此借病不见客和不出席重要会议,以示「抗议」。

    但他估计,习近平此举不会增加他的权力,因为习的班底不强,难以与人争权。而他的健康亦不容他有魄力去争权。
